Elizabeth Hurley is finally letting the world in on why her heart is racing again. In recent interviews, she admitted she went nearly a decade without real love until Billy Ray Cyrus entered her life. Now she describes their romance as “fabulous,” a vibrant celebration after years of emotional drought.
Hurley and Cyrus made their relationship Instagram official in April 2025, sharing a cozy Easter photo. Their chemistry was first hinted years earlier while filming Christmas in Paradise in 2022, but only now has it blossomed fully. Sources say Hurley reached out during a difficult phase in Cyrus’s life, and their bond strengthened from there.
On The Today Show, Hurley shared what ties them together: a love for nature, the countryside, and artistic expression. She said the alignment in passion and mindset deepens their connection. She also revealed that Cyrus recently spent four months with her in England, the longest stretch they’ve spent together in one place, calling the experience “fabulous.”
